- W2340589050 abstract "The petrogenesis of high Sr/Y-type magmas is still open to debate. Usually, such magmas could result from melting under high-pressure settings (> 12 kbar). In this paper, we gave an example that some high Sr/Y-type magmas could originate from melting of crustal materials at pressure of 10–12 kbar. We carried out a study of petrogenesis for Devonian high Sr/Y granites from the Beidashan batholith (397–411 Ma), southwestern Alxa Block, Northwest China. The Beidashan granites have SiO2 (69.21–74.60 wt.%) and Al2O3 (14.01–16.20 wt.%) with A/CNK ratios of 0.99–1.08. According to their trace element compositions and whole-rock zirconium saturation temperatures (TZr), the Beidashan granites can be divided into two groups: Group I ((Dy/Yb)N = 1.2–3.0, Eu/Eu* = 0.77–1.3, TZr = 761–856 °C), resulted from fluid-absent partial melting of mafic to intermediate crustal materials leaving garnet residuum at pressure of ~ 12 kbar, and Group II ((Dy/Yb)N = 0.76–2.16, Eu/Eu* = 1.7–5.3, TZr = 651–785 °C), formed by fluid-present melting of mafic to intermediate crustal materials with residual amphibole in the source at pressure of ~ 10 kbar. Both Group I and Group II show high Sr/Y and (La/Yb)N features. They show ISr = 0.7134–0.7180, εNd(t) = − 6.61 to − 9.71, T2DM = 1.7–1.9 Ga; εHf(t) = − 5.6 to − 9.9 and TDMC = 1.7–2.0 Ga, indicating that the Beidashan high Sr/Y granites were derived from melting of crustal basement materials. Our results suggest that some high Sr/Y-type granites formed under relatively lower pressure conditions (~ 10–12 kbar), and they could not be an indicative of partial melting of thickened crust." @default.
